If you have decided that a mobile app is just what your business needs right now, the next step is to locate a capable app developer. You should take some time to research before you make a decision. After all, your business’ reputation is at stake, since an app that is unimpressive or frequently malfunctions can frustrate users. Instead of wasting your money on an incompetent developer, learn what to look for in a reputable company.
Experience
Not surprisingly, it is best to choose a company that has been developing apps for years. Of course, since mobile apps have not even been around for a decade, it may be hard to find a company with a long history in this business. That’s why you should consider companies that have been developing software for decades and apps for years. You do not want to leave this job to an amateur, unless you want an app that is memorable for all the wrong reasons.
Customer Service
One of the first things you need to find out is who you will be working with during the development process. Even if you choose a large company, it is important that you have contact with just a few individuals. Otherwise, you may feel that you and your ideas become lost in a sea of employees who are not truly listening to you. The ability to work one-on-one with a project manager is paramount if you want to ensure your preferences are heard. When you have brief contact with a dozen employees, you are unlikely to get the results you desire since they may not understand your business or your objectives for the app.
User Experience
You need to make sure the app appeals to your audience. To do this, check out an app developed by the company you are considering. Pay attention to how easy it is to use, as well as how fast it loads. Once you are done using the app, ask yourself how satisfied you are with the experience. Was it worth your time, and would you use it again? If you are not sure, continue experimenting with apps until you find one you enjoy, and then contact the developer.
Price
This is likely already on your mind, and while it should not dictate your entire decision, it should factor into it. You need to make sure you can afford the cost of the app, which means you should request a written quote from the developers you are considering. If it fits into your budget, find out how and when you can pay the total. Make sure you know the details before you sign any contracts.
In fact, you should learn all of these details prior to committing to an app developer. An app should help your business, not hinder it, so it is worth your time to ensure you choose the right professional for the job.
